About Shangri-La Asia's Workforce

Shangri-La Asia Ltd. (69) is a Hospitality and Tourism Management company that employs 12,666 people worldwide as of March 2026. It is the 6th-largest by headcount among its peers. Founded in 1971, the company is headquartered in Hong Kong, Hong Kong and trades on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ange.

Shangri-La Asia's workforce has grown 3.3% from 2023 to 2026, though it is down 1.3% year over year in 2026. Its workforce is concentrated most in the Philippines (20.6%), followed by China (12.4%) and Malaysia (9.7%), with Singapore, its fastest-growing location.

Shangri-La Asia's largest functional groups are Finance and Operations (51.6%), Engineering (28.8%), and Sales and Marketing (19.6%). Median employee tenure is 2.9 years. The average salary is $20,092, ranging from a median of $40,000 in Pacific Islands to $6,000 in Southern Asia.

Shangri-La Asia's active job postings fell 63.5% in 2026 to 29, with new postings per month cooling from 50 in 2023 to 12 in 2026. Overall employee sentiment is neutral but declining.

The Philippines accounts for the largest share of Shangri-La Asia's global workforce with approximately 21% of total employees, followed by China and Malaysia. Shangri-La Asia's headcount in Singapore is growing fastest among its major locations, up 0.6% year over year in 2026.

Shangri-La Asia employees by country — 2026

CountryEmployees% of TotalYoY %
Philippines2,60220.6%-0.2%
China1,57212.4%-1.4%
Malaysia1,2239.7%-0.6%
Indonesia9537.5%-3.0%
India9287.3%+0.3%
France5834.6%-1.5%
Singapore5154.1%+0.6%
Thailand4283.4%-2.3%
United Kingdom4253.4%-16.4%
Australia3612.9%+5.4%
